Tips for Safe and Efficient Dumpster Placement

Preparing the property before a dumpster arrives ensures smooth delivery and setup. Clear access ensures that delivery and placement go smoothly without obstacles. Homeowners should choose a flat, stable area for the dumpster. Removing vehicles or other items from the area creates sufficient space and reduces the risk of damage. Thoughtful placement supports smooth operation. Taking these steps ahead of time ensures a smooth start to cleanup.

Protecting the surface beneath the dumpster is another important consideration. Driveways or paved areas are less likely to get damaged with proper preparation. Clear communication about placement preferences helps ensure the container is positioned correctly from the start. Homeowners who prepare their space often experience fewer issues during the rental period. Proper placement ensures the dumpster is easy to use. These small preparations help maximize convenience and safety.

Loading the Dumpster Safely and Efficiently

How a dumpster is loaded affects both efficiency and safety. Distributing weight evenly creates a balanced load. Placing heavier items at the bottom prevents shifting. Breaking down large items allows for better organization and more efficient use of the container. Consistent loading practices ensure safer handling. Homeowners who plan loading carefully maximize efficiency.

Safety should always be top of mind. Wearing protective gear and following safety precautions prevents accidents is recommended. Keeping the area around the dumpster clear ensures safer work conditions. Avoiding overfilling keeps cleanup manageable. Thoughtful loading habits help the rental run efficiently. These practices protect both people and property throughout the project.
